The analysis

The claim states a foundational textbook fact of general relativity: the vacuum Einstein field equations (R_mu_nu = 0) admit non-trivial solutions that describe gravitational waves (such as linearized plane waves or exact pp-waves) and black holes (such as the Schwarzschild and Kerr metrics).
